This book explores the relationship between atmospheric conditions and extreme fire behavior, guiding fire control men and weather forecasters towards more effective wildfire management. The author presents a series of case-history fires, revealing patterns in weather conditions and fuel types that lead to blowups and conflagrations. From these, the book develops a unifying concept linking stability conditions, wind speed, and wind shear in the atmosphere to fuel conditions on the ground, resulting in a practical classification system for potential fire behavior. The author's findings provide crucial insights into recognizing and predicting dangerous conditions, ultimately improving wildfire safety protocols and minimizing potential devastation.
